Output 038c45a5063ea002a90409a42d686e905344c63b3a63bb3354c1423d006ec15d:23

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e7da78032f236e54e792a721cc722d82b09b6f0e58c86793b3f5fe9c187e89a
address
bc1pne760qpj7gmw2nne9fepe3ezmq4sndhsukxgv7fm8a07nsv8azdqqaf0qd
transaction
038c45a5063ea002a90409a42d686e905344c63b3a63bb3354c1423d006ec15d
spent
true